Output Shaft Disassemble
^ Tools Required:- J 34757 Snap Ring Remover and Installer
- Or Equivalent
1. Remove the four case extension bolts (5).
2. Remove the case extension assembly (6) and remove the extension seal (8).
3. Leave the front differential carrier thrust washer (715) and the bearing (714) on the carrier.
4. Rotate the differential carrier until you can see the end of the output shaft.
5. Rotate the output shaft while holding the carrier, until the opening on the drive shaft snap ring is visible.
6. Use J 34757 in order to push the snap ring (512) partially off of the output shaft.
7. Remove the snap ring with needle nose pliers.
Important: Be careful not to damage the bearing on the output shaft.
8. Pull the output shaft (510) out of the transmission.
